Understanding the Fishin Frenzy Gameplay Experience

Fishin Frenzy is a vibrant, quick online slot. People love it for its straightforward play and its rewarding free spins bonus. It has five reels and a friendly fishing theme. Land three or more scatter symbols, and you’ll start the Fisherman’s Free Spins round. This easy action operates well for a quick five-minute play or a extended, relaxed session. How much you like it depends on crisp graphics, controls that work immediately, and seamless animation. These aspects can feel quite distinct on a home PC versus a smartphone. Comparing Visuals and Efficiency

Technically, desktops generally have greater raw power and visual clarity. Using a widescreen monitor at high resolution keeps the frame rate smooth, which makes winning animations look great. But phones have caught up. High-end smartphones and tablets with OLED screens provide incredible colour and sharpness that can beat some desktop monitors. The real difference now is frequently just size: a big monitor draws you in, while a phone screen fits all the detail into a smaller, denser space. How well the game runs on mobile depends on your phone’s processor. Newer models manage the animations perfectly, but older ones might stutter a little when a bonus starts.

Power Duration and Play Duration Considerations

If you game on mobile, you must consider battery life. A lengthy session of Fishin Frenzy, particularly with a vivid screen, can drain your battery fast. You may need to locate a charger or carry a power bank. Desktop players, hooked up to the wall, can game as much as they want without worrying. This makes the computer the clear pick for a all-day gaming afternoon. Mobile is more suitable for briefer, intense bursts of play where you keep an eye on your battery. Playing hard can also cause your phone become hot, which can be a bit bothersome during a long session away from a socket.
